    Since most global trade is parts and components en route to eventual final assembly, simple bi-lateral trade numbers tell an incomplete picture.

    • “China happens to be at the end of many Asian value chains, taking sophisticated components from Japan, the Republic of Korea, and Chinese Taipei and assembling these into final products.”
    • “the Chinese domestic value content of their exports of ICT (information and communication technology) products accounts for only around half the total export value.”
    • “the US trade deficit in ICT products with China is cut roughly in half if the calculation is made in value added terms.”
